    Bauernbrot --German Farmers Bread

    Source of Recipe

    Recipe by Gerry Cole

    List of Ingredients

    Day one:
    2 cups unbleached all purpose flour
    2 cups water
    1 tablespoon dry yeast
    1 tablespoon sugar

    Use large bowl - stir together with wire whisk, cover with towel and let sit 24 hours.

    Day 2 :
    Stir the mixture again and let sit another 24 hours.

    Day 3
    Mix 4 cups white rye flour (I buy this on E-Bay in 50 lb bags)
    2 cups all purpose unbleached flour
    1/4 cup dry instant mashed potatoes
    1/2 teaspoon sugar
    1 tablespoon salt
    all of the above sour dough
    5 1/2 ounces warm water






    Recipe

    I mix this in a large mixer with dough hook about 7 minutes.

    place in bowl sprayed with a non-stick spray, cover with towel and let sit 1 hour.

    After 1 hour mix again with dough hook for 3 minutes.

    Dough will be heavy and a little sticky - may need a spatula to get it out of the mixer.

    Shape into 1 large bread or 2 small breads and let rise on a cookie sheet for 1 hour. (at about 1/2 hour turn oven on to 425 degrees) ((prepare cookie sheet with parchment or corn meal))

    Bake for 45 minutes in middle rack of oven (I turn mine about 1/2 way so it bakes evenly)

    Brush with butter as soon as it comes out of oven. Let cool before cutting. This bread freezes well.
